Georges Saab is a scholar working on Nephrology,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Rheumatology. According to data from OpenAlex, Georges Saab has authored 41 papers receiving a total of 1.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 25 papers in Nephrology, 10 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 7 papers in Rheumatology. Recurrent topics in Georges Saab’s work include Parathyroid Disorders and Treatments (15 papers), Chronic Kidney Disease and Diabetes (10 papers) and Dialysis and Renal Disease Management (6 papers). Georges Saab is often cited by papers focused on Parathyroid Disorders and Treatments (15 papers), Chronic Kidney Disease and Diabetes (10 papers) and Dialysis and Renal Disease Management (6 papers). Georges Saab coll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Lebanon. Georges Saab's co-authors include Keith A. Hruska, Suresh Mathew, Richard Lund, Daniel C. Brennan, Adam Whaley‐Connell, David A. Axelrod, Kevin C. Abbott, Paolo R. Salvalaggio, Suying Li and Connie L. Davis and has published in prestigious journals such as New England Journal of Medicine, Circulation Research and The Journal of Clinical Endocrinology & Metabolism.
